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G Antibody Market - Global Forecast 2026-2032

The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G Antibody Market size was estimated at USD 108.11 million in 2025 and expected to reach USD 116.59 million in 2026, at a CAGR of 7.32% to reach USD 177.34 million by 2032.

Empowering Immunology and Diagnostics with Highly Specific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G Antibodies to Drive Innovative Research Outcomes

In recent years, the role of goat anti-rabbit IgG antibodies has evolved from a niche specialty reagent to a cornerstone of immunodetection in both academic research and diagnostic laboratories. These antibodies, which bind specifically to rabbit immunoglobulins, serve as indispensable secondary reagents in a wide array of assays, enabling the visualization and quantification of target antigens with high sensitivity and specificity. Their versatility has been bolstered by advances in conjugation chemistries, allowing seamless integration into colorimetric, fluorescent, and chemiluminescent platforms.

The surge in demand for precise molecular insights has catalyzed broader adoption across diverse fields, including oncology biomarker analysis, infectious disease diagnostics, and cell biology research. This expanding application horizon is mirrored by parallel innovations in assay development, where goat anti-rabbit IgG reagents underpin next-generation methodologies such as multiplex immunoassays and digital pathology workflows. Transformative Advances in Antibody Engineering and Detection Technologies Shaping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G Applications Across Research and Diagnostics

The landscape of secondary antibody reagents is undergoing a transformative shift driven by novel antibody engineering techniques and advanced conjugation technologies. Recombinant production methods now allow the design of goat anti-rabbit IgG formats with enhanced binding affinities and reduced lot-to-lot variability, addressing long-standing concerns over reagent consistency. These recombinant formats, often expressed in mammalian cell systems, also facilitate the removal of undesired glycosylation patterns and minimize background signals in sensitive assays.

At the same time, site-specific conjugation strategies have emerged as game changers for integrating enzymes, fluorophores, and biotin moieties without compromising antibody integrity. This precision attachment enhances signal-to-noise ratios and broadens the range of compatible detection systems. Furthermore, the integration of digital imaging and artificial intelligence in immunohistochemistry has ushered in a new era of quantifiable tissue analysis. Software-driven image analysis platforms can now calibrate signal intensities from goat anti-rabbit IgG-based stains, providing robust, reproducible data sets for clinical research and biomarker validation.

Analyzing the Cumulative Impact of Emerging United States Tariffs on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G Supply Chains and Cost Dynamics in 2025

In 2025, the imposition of new tariffs on imported laboratory reagents has exerted a cumulative impact on the goat anti-rabbit IgG antibody market in the United States. Cost pressures have intensified as manufacturers contend with elevated duties on critical raw materials, including coupled enzymes and specialized conjugation linkers sourced abroad. These added expenses have cascaded through the supply chain, prompting reagent providers to reassess pricing models, renegotiate supplier contracts, and explore domestic sourcing options.

As a result, several leading antibody producers have restructured their procurement strategies, forging partnerships with domestic enzyme manufacturers and resin suppliers to mitigate tariff-induced cost hikes. While some innovators have absorbed a portion of the increased expenses through operational efficiencies, others have strategically layered price adjustments into premium product lines, emphasizing enhanced performance attributes to justify higher price points. Moving forward, the market’s resilience will hinge on the ability of stakeholders to navigate evolving trade policies, optimize local manufacturing capacities, and maintain transparent communication with end users about shifting cost structures.

Critical Segmentation Perspectives Revealing Application, Product Type, End User and Label Preferences Driven by Evolving Research Demands

Insights into the goat anti-rabbit IgG market reveal that applications drive both demand and innovation. Elisa platforms remain foundational, with competitive, indirect, and sandwich formats each addressing distinct sensitivity and specificity needs. Flow cytometry applications benefit from fluorescently labeled secondary antibodies, enabling multi-parameter cell analysis and deep phenotyping. Immunohistochemistry continues to expand as biomarker discovery and tissue pathology require robust staining protocols, while western blot and immunoprecipitation assays persist as staple techniques for protein identification and interaction studies.

Product type segmentation highlights the differentiation between full antibodies and fragments, with Fab and Fab2 fragments gaining traction in applications where reduced steric hindrance and enhanced tissue penetration are critical. End users span academic and research institutes pursuing fundamental discoveries, contract research organizations delivering outsourced experimental services, diagnostic laboratories focusing on disease detection, and pharmaceutical and biotech companies engaged in therapeutic development. The choice of label-biotin, fluorescent tags, horseradish peroxidase, or unlabeled formats-further refines reagent selection based on assay sensitivity requirements and instrumentation compatibility. Both liquid and lyophilized forms accommodate user preferences for storage stability and operational convenience. Finally, purity grades from crude preparations to affinity-purified and ion exchange-purified formats ensure that researchers can balance cost efficiencies with stringent performance demands.

Regional Dynamics Influencing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G Antibody Adoption Patterns Across the Americas, EMEA, and Asia-Pacific

Regional analysis underscores distinct adoption dynamics across the globe. In the Americas, robust life science infrastructure, coupled with leading academic institutions and a thriving biotech sector, sustains steady consumption of goat anti-rabbit IgG reagents. Strategic investments in domestic manufacturing and distribution networks have strengthened supply chain reliability, enabling timely fulfillment of research and diagnostic needs.

Europe, Middle East & Africa (EMEA) presents a heterogeneous landscape where regulatory harmonization in the European Union coexists with emerging life science hubs in the Middle East. High regulatory standards in Europe drive a preference for reagents with comprehensive quality documentation and batch-traceable production records, while cost sensitivities in certain African markets encourage adoption of basic liquid-form reagents. Asia-Pacific has emerged as a fast-growing region, propelled by rapid expansion of pharmaceutical research in China, Japan, and South Korea, alongside significant investments in academic genomics centers in India and Australia. Local production capabilities are steadily increasing to meet regional demand and alleviate dependency on imported reagents.
